In the Hebrew Bible, the word nephesh ( נֶ֫פֶשׁ ) is often translated as the "breath of life." This is a book of poems which the author hopes will breathe life into those who are currently in quarantine, providing them a source of intellectual amusement and taking their minds off of their current worries, at least to some extent. The poems have overtones of puzzles through word-play and double meanings, yet still strive to remain accessible through the pure joy of word-sounds and syllabic rhythm. Re-reading them should provide the means to gain additional insight and play over time, inviting the reader to revisit the book years into the future.
